To fetch audio data using the Axios library in Node.js and play it using the Web Audio API, you can follow these steps:
1. Fetch the Audio Data
Use Axios to make a POST request to the ElevenLabs API and retrieve the audio data as a binary stream. Ensure you include the necessary headers and parameters.
import axios from "axios";
const fetchAudioData = async () => {
try {
const response = await axios({
method: "post",
url: "https://api.elevenlabs.io/v1/text-to-speech/<your_voice_id>/stream",
params: {
model_id: "eleven_multilingual_v2",
output_format: "mp3_44100_128", // Specify the desired format
},
data: {
text: "Hello, this is a test message.",
voice_settings: {
stability: 0.5,
similarity_boost: 0.8,
},
},
headers: {
"xi-api-key": "<your_api_key>",
"Content-Type": "application/json",
},
responseType: "arraybuffer", // Expect binary data
});
return response.data; // Return the audio data
} catch (error) {
console.error("Error fetching audio data:", error.message || error);
if (error.response) {
console.error("Response status:", error.response.status);
console.error("Response headers:", error.response.headers);
}
}
};
2. Play the Audio Using Web Audio API
Once you have the audio data, you can decode it and play it using the Web Audio API.
const playAudio = async (audioData) => {
try {
const audioContext = new (window.AudioContext || window.webkitAudioContext)();
const audioBuffer = await audioContext.decodeAudioData(audioData);
const source = audioContext.createBufferSource();
source.buffer = audioBuffer;
source.connect(audioContext.destination);
source.start(0); // Play the audio immediately
console.log("Audio is playing...");
} catch (error) {
console.error("Error playing audio:", error);
}
};
// Fetch and play the audio
const main = async () => {
const audioData = await fetchAudioData();
if (audioData) {
playAudio(audioData);
}
};
main();
Key Points
- Replace
<your_voice_id>and<your_api_key>with your actual ElevenLabs voice ID and API key. - Ensure the
output_formatmatches your requirements (e.g., MP3 format). - The
responseType: "arraybuffer"in Axios ensures the audio data is fetched as binary data, which is required for decoding with the Web Audio API.
This code will fetch the audio data from the ElevenLabs API and play it using the Web Audio API in the browser.
